I'd suggest you try any of the gunner classes. You may not do much damage with your low ATP, but the SE's can offset, especially since Newman's have the second highest ATA of the races.

Guntecher, maybe? If you were an AT you should already have some techs leveled, and you've already got twin handguns. You won't do as much damage as a Cast GT (for example) but GT is more of a support role anyway and often relies on SEs to get things done.

Try using Range-Mags to supplement your damage. Newmans' high TP will be a big asset, since that weapon uses the TP stat for damage. Only Acrofighters and Guntechers can use the S rank Range-Mags, but the A rank ones are arguably better for damage anyway.

If you're looking for a non techer approach, i'd say go acrofighter. RCSM damage will be second to none, your evasion will be higher than any race/class combination, and it breaks the whole "newman techer" stereotype (which i approve of greatly).

I've just gone Newman WT in preparation for Masterforce and I'm finding it surprisingly enjoyable - currently at class lv8, Vivi Danga is a great AOE skill and while you're not going to out-DPS many classes, you can certainly make yourself handy.

They're a bit fragile to begin with though, just be careful - at 124/1 I had about 1600 HP and quite often got destroyed by Gaozoran Foie.
